How much is the rent According to Henri Olivier - analyst «Polaris France» - rent in Nice, in the last trimester of 2007 was 13.61 euros per square meter. This is somewhat less than in the previous trimester, when the price was 13.84 euros, but Monsieur Olivier believes this decrease is the result of seasonal fluctuations. In Cannes, on the contrary, the rent has increased and at year end was 14.36 euros per square meter against 14.25 in the summer. Marseille rental rate for the six months remained unchanged, and the rental price per square meter is equal to 12.34 euros against 12.33 in the summer. This constancy is easily explained: Marcel is not a resort and port city. Therefore, prices are not subject to seasonal fluctuations. Thus, the average rent on the Cote d'Azur was the end of last year, 13.4 euros. Therefore, we can say with certainty that take a single bed apartment will be likely for 700 euros per month or 980 dollars. Even in Cannes - the most expensive French Riviera town you do not pass this "odnospalku" more than 750 euros. Some owners manage to deliver housing and for 800 euros, "dvuspalku" (in our opinion - three rubles) usually sit at a thousand. It is interesting to compare this with the Moscow rental prices. Approximately the same area on a small "kopeck piece" in Moscow, you can take in about 800-900 euros per month. However, do not forget about the paid services management company - about 50-70 euros per month, which will take all the hassle. With regard to public utilities, the monthly allowance of such an apartment cost about 100 euros. Finally, we must take into account the rise in property prices. After investing money in the Côte d'Azur has always been considered not only prestigious, but also profitable. As prices rose in the cities by the sea since 1998, property prices only and did what they were raised - over these ten years the cost of the local housing rose by 1.7 times. The peak rise in prices took place in 2002 - 2005 years, when prices rose by 47.7 percent over 3 years! Prior to 1998, prices rose very, very sparingly, adding 3 per cent per year, but then real estate Riviera enjoyed stable demand, which is not the last to create our "crimson jackets." However, in the last year the growth rate slowed dramatically. According to the INSEE (National Institute of Statistics and Economic Studies), property prices in France have increased over the past 2007 to 5.6 percent for apartments (flats) and a 5.7 per cent at home. Compared to previous years growth has slowed quite significantly, because in 2005 it was 12.2 percent, and in 2006 - 10 percent. This is for the whole of France. On the Riviera, the growth was only 3.3 percent - in 1995-99, respectively. As for the rise in the Moscow housing, according to analysts GC "Relight Group", at 10.1 percent.
